Sensi offers new attachment and vibration speeds to provide an array of options for sensory stimulation. The new tool brings enhanced design and function to OPT, sometimes referred to as Oral Motor Therapy, through the following features:

  • 15 innovative tips in kid-friendly colors and softer material offering an array of new therapy options
  • New ergonomic base that fits old and new tips and takes standard AAA batteries
  • Easy attachment method means no hassle tip change
  • One click multi-speed operation with pulse and memory feature

Leaders in the industry for 30 years, TalkTools® has positioned itself as the authoritative worldwide source for oral placement, sensory, and feeding therapy supplies for therapists and parents. Its therapy techniques add a tactile component to feeding and speech therapy, enabling clients to “feel” the movements necessary for the development of speech clarity.
